二、高频词汇拓展
health (n.) 健康 → healthy (adj.) 健康的 → unhealthy (adj.) 不健康的
ill (adj.) 生病的 → illness (n.) 疾病
problem (n.) 问题 → have a problem with... 在...方面有问题
matter (n.) 事情;麻烦 → What‘s the matter 怎么了?
hurt (v.) 使受伤;疼痛 → hurt (adj.) 受伤的 (过去式/过去分词: hurt)
pain (n.) 疼痛 → painful (adj.) 疼痛的
medicine (n.) 药 → take medicine 吃药
dentist (n.) 牙医 → see a dentist 看牙医
fever (n.) 发烧 → have a fever 发烧
stomachache (n.) 胃痛 → have a stomachache 胃痛
headache (n.) 头痛 → have a headache 头痛
toothache (n.) 牙痛 → have a toothache 牙痛
sore (adj.) 疼痛的 → have a sore throat/back 喉咙/背痛
rest (v.&n.) 休息 → have/take a rest 休息一下
exercise (v.&n.) 锻炼 → do exercise 做锻炼
habit (n.) 习惯 → good/bad habits 好/坏习惯
usually (adv.) 通常 → usual (adj.) 通常的
early (adj.&adv.) 早的(地) → get up early 早起
late (adj.&adv.) 晚的(地);迟的(地) → be late for... ...迟到
quick (adj.) 快的 → quickly (adv.) 快速地
busy (adj.) 忙碌的 → be busy (doing) sth. 忙于(做)某事
fruit (n.) 水果 (通常不可数,指种类时可数)
taste (v.) 尝起来 → taste good/bad 尝起来好/坏
enough (adj.&adv.) 足够的(地) → enough water 足够的水
feel (v.) 感觉 → feel happy/sick/tired 感到快乐/恶心/疲倦
happy (adj.) 快乐的 → happiness (n.) 幸福
sad (adj.) 悲伤的 → sadness (n.) 悲伤
angry (adj.) 生气的 → anger (n.) 愤怒
surprised (adj.) 惊讶的 → be surprised at... 对...感到惊讶
relaxed (adj.) 放松的 → relaxing (adj.) 令人放松的
worry (v.&n.) 担心 → worry about... 担心...
pressure (n.) 压力 → under pressure 在压力下
accident (n.) 事故 → by accident 意外地
unexpected (adj.) 意外的 → expect (v.) 期待
happen (v.) 发生 → What happened 发生了什么?
decision (n.) 决定 → make a decision 做决定
risk (n.&v.) 风险;冒险 → take risks 冒险
spirit (n.) 精神 → in good spirits 情绪好
die (v.) 死亡 → dead (adj.) 死的 → death (n.) 死亡
save (v.) 拯救;节省 → save one’s life 挽救某人的生命

四、核心语法聚焦
1. 情态动词 should 的用法
功能:用于提出建议或意见,表示“应该”。
结构:主语 + should/shouldn’t + 动词原形 + 其他.
例句:
You should lie down and rest. 你应该躺下休息。
She shouldn’t eat too much junk food. 她不应该吃太多垃圾食品。
疑问句:Should + 主语 + 动词原形 + 其他?
Should I take some medicine 我应该吃点药吗?
2. 动词 make 的使役用法
功能:表示“使/让某人(产生某种感觉或做某事)”。
结构:
make + sb. + 形容词 (使某人感到...)
Rainy days make me feel sad. 雨天让我感到悲伤。
make + sb. + 动词原形 (使某人做...)
His joke made us laugh. 他的笑话让我们大笑。
3. 过去完成时 (Past Perfect Tense)
功能:表示在过去某一时间或动作之前已经发生或完成的动作(即“过去的过去”)。
结构:主语 + had + 动词的过去分词 + 其他.
标志词:by the time, when, before, after 等引导的时间状语从句。
例句:
By the time I got to the bus stop, the bus had already left.
当我到达车站时,公交车已经开走了。
I had finished my homework before my mother came back.
在我妈妈回来之前,我已经完成了作业。
4. 反身代词 (Reflexive Pronouns)
形式:myself, yourself, himself, herself, itself, ourselves, yourselves, themselves
用法:
作宾语,表示动作返回到执行者本身。
He hurt himself when playing soccer. 他踢足球时伤到了自己。
Please take good care of yourself. 请照顾好你自己。
作同位语,起强调作用。
I myself made the cake. 我自己做的蛋糕。
五、考点透析与精题巧练
考点一:情态动词 should 与 had better 的辨析
should 语气较委婉,是一般性的建议。
had better 语气较强,带有“最好”做某事,否则可能会有不好后果的意味,后接动词原形,否定式为 had better not do。
精题巧练:
You look tired. You ______ go to bed early tonight.
A. would like to B. should C. had better D. could
答案:B 。B 语气更通用,C 语气更强。根据语境,选择B 更合适。
It’s raining heavily. You ______ go out now.
Shouldn’t B. had better not C. wouldn’t D. mustn’t
答案:B。强调“最好不要”,否则会淋湿。
考点二:动词 make 的固定搭配
make a decision 做决定 make friends (with) (与...)交朋友
make progress 取得进步 make sure 确保
make the bed 整理床铺 make money 赚钱
精题巧练:
The good news ______ us very happy.
A. made B. let C. had D. helped
答案:A。make sb. + adj. 结构。
考点三:过去完成时与一般过去时的区别
关键在于判断动作发生的先后顺序。过去完成时表示“较早的过去”,一般过去时表示“较晚的过去”或单纯叙述过去事实。
精题巧练:
By the end of last month, we ______ four English parties.
have had B. had C. had had D. have
答案:C。“by the end of last month”是明确的过去时间点,在此时间点之前已经完成的动作用过去完成时。
考点四:反身代词的用法
记住固定搭配:enjoy oneself (玩得开心), teach oneself (自学), help oneself to... (请自用...), by oneself (独自地)。
精题巧练:The little girl is too young to look after ______.
her B. she C. hers D. herself
答案:D。look after oneself 照顾自己。
考点五:enough 的位置
enough 修饰名词时,可前置或后置:enough time 或 time enough (更常见前置)。
enough 修饰形容词或副词时,必须后置:old enough, carefully enough。
精题巧练:
He is not ______ to go to school.
A.enough old B. old enough C. enough young D. young enough
答案:B。
